While the requirements across all organizations with … WebA Certificate of Waiver allows a facility to perform only tests that are classified as waived. As defined by CLIA, waived tests are “simple laboratory examinations and procedures that have an insignificant risk of an erroneous result.”. Examples of waived tests include: dipstick urinalysis, fecal occult blood, urine pregnancy tests, and ...
